Plans for rival trampoline parks next door to each other on the outskirts of Chester have been given the go ahead.Firms Flip Out and Jump Xtreme had both applied to set up attractions on Chester Gates Business Park.While trampoline parks are already up and running in Deeside, Liverpool and Winsford, there is still a gap in the Chester market.Cheshire West and Chester Council have now green lit both plans, opening up the possibility for them to move in.Each firm is claiming to be on the verge of setting up 50,000ft arenas at the Dunkirk base, which would be two of the largest in the world.Flip Out are expanding from their first UK site in Stoke.They say a £2m investment would allow them to create 100 jobs.Tattenhall-based Jump Xtreme are looking to come home make and Chester their ‘special’ headquarters.The company already has trampoline parks in Bolton and Tamworth.
